Here are some best practices for social posts

  • Use a clear CTA with your affiliate link (and an optional discount code – available upon request!).

  • Use strong visuals (before/after, clean calendar dashboards, real user quotes).

  • Include hashtags relevant to productivity, time-management, remote work (e.g., #DeepWork, #WorkSmarter, #CalendarHacks).

  • Be authentic: share your own experience with Reclaim to drive better engagement.

  • Track performance: which post types drive click-throughs/conversions – tailor future updates where you've experienced success!

  • Promote paid features! If you're only promoting free features, you're 10x less likely to convert your referrals into paid customers.
